In 2017, Harrison received a salary of $325,278. The organization's “chief water officer” received $293,442 . In 2019, a new program was created to allow entrepreneurs to donate equity to Charity: water. When their companies are sold or go public, some of the proceeds are paid to the charity's employees as bonuses.

How does charity: water make money?

The 100% Model is powered by a small and dedicated group of private donors, known as The Well. These entrepreneurs, artists, musicians and business leaders fund our overhead costs – costs that include office rent, staff salaries and benefits, flights, and even the toner for our copy machine.

Who is the CEO of charity: water?

SCOTT HARRISON is the founder and CEO of charity: water, a non-profit that has mobilized over one million donors around the world to fund over 78,000 water projects in 29 countries that will serve more than 13 million people.

Why is charity: water so successful?

While Charity: Water does work on a 100% model, the real reason behind their success is how they showcase their efficiency . By showing it's supporters where every dollar ends up, Charity: Water is building trust and a tangible connection between its donors and the initiative.
